Data-Driven Decision Making in Freight Logistics
In the dynamic realm of freight logistics, effectiveness is paramount. Businesses are increasingly harnessing data to make strategic decisions that enhance overall performance. Data-driven insights provide critical intelligence into multifaceted aspects of the supply chain, facilitating companies to maximize routes, minimize costs, and enhance customer satisfaction.
- Live tracking of shipments provides visibility into each stage of the transport process.
- Predictive analytics can highlight potential bottlenecks, allowing for anticipatory measures to be taken.
- Consumption forecasting helps organizations modify their inventory levels and allocate resources effectively.
By implementing data-driven decision making, freight logistics operators can secure a competitive edge in the market.
Building Sustainable Practices in Freight Transportation
The transportation industry plays a crucial role in the global economy, but it also contributes a significant amount of greenhouse gas output. Therefore, building sustainable practices in freight transportation is necessary to reduce its environmental effect. This involves incorporating a range of strategies, such as improving delivery systems, employing more green vehicles, and supporting intermodal transportation. By adopting these sustainable practices, the freight industry can lower its carbon footprint while ensuring efficient activities.
